What were the ways of development chosen by countries of South Caucasus (Transcaucasia), which were part of Russian Empire after the October Revolution? What kind of attitude did the Georgian political parties had about Soviet Russia? What did Georgia go through in this short period: from October 1917 till 26th of May 1918, till establishing the independent republic of Georgia? These are questions, which will be answered and discussed in the research topic. From 15th of November, 1917 Commissariat of Transcaucasus started functioning in Tbilisi. By this new regional governmental body Transcaucasus officially declared its separation from Soviet Russia. The end of the Transcaucasian Democratic Federative Republic was marked on May 26, 1918, when the Democratic Republic of Georgia declared independence.
